About Bingle
Bingle is a young, goofy boy with a sweet nature. He can be a little unsure around new people, dogs, and environments, and will do best in a calm home that can offer structure, routine, and patience.
Bingle will benefit from crate training, giving him a safe space to relax when he's feeling worried or overwhelmed. He does struggle with separation anxiety and will need support to feel secure when left alone, starting with very short absences and gradually building up. A home where someone is around more often than not would suit him best, along with secure fencing.
Slow, positive introductions to new people are recommended. Bingle prefers to approach in his own time, with visitors crouching side‑on, avoiding direct eye contact, and gently tossing treats to help him feel safe.
Once comfortable, Bingle can become quite excitable and will benefit from ongoing work on impulse control, calm behaviours, and brain games. Daily enrichment, quiet walks, and sniffy adventures will help meet his needs. He is a clever boy who would enjoy some basic manners training and being included in calm family activities around the home. Busy environments may be a little too much for him at this stage.
Bingle would be best suited as the only dog for now. He does show some fear‑based dog reactivity and can become overwhelmed, but with calm, known dogs and supported, on‑lead interactions, he has shown the ability to improve.
With the right home and guidance, Bingle will make a rewarding and loving companion. 🐾
